Excessive dealing with could cause segregation on the program and good aggregates. Wetting up the concrete so it may be raked or pushed right into a spot far from the place it really is discharged is not really satisfactory.
Concrete has rather significant compressive energy, but A lot reduce tensile energy.[106] Consequently, it is normally reinforced with elements that are robust in rigidity (usually steel). The elasticity of concrete is comparatively regular at minimal strain levels but begins lowering at increased worry concentrations as matrix cracking develops.

It brings together the compressive energy of concrete with the tensile energy of steel reinforcement, resulting in a material that may withstand higher loads and forces.
Concrete, as being the Romans knew it, was a different and groundbreaking material. Laid in the shape of arches, vaults and domes, it promptly hardened into a rigid mass, no cost from a lot of The interior thrusts and strains that troubled the builders of comparable buildings in stone or brick.[22]

Steel reinforcement within reinforced concrete can corrode eventually when exposed to dampness and chloride ions, leading to structural deterioration and diminished load-bearing site potential.
The very long-expression sturdiness of Roman concrete structures was found being because of the presence of pyroclastic (volcanic) rock and ash while in the concrete mix. The crystallization of strätlingite (a complex calcium aluminosilicate hydrate)[26] throughout the formation from the concrete and its merging with comparable calcium–aluminium-silicate–hydrate structures served provide the Roman concrete a better degree of fracture resistance as compared to present day concrete.
The important thing to achieving a robust, sturdy concrete rests around the careful proportioning and mixing with the substances. A concrete mixture that doesn't have ample paste to fill many of the voids involving the aggregates is going to be difficult to position and will develop rough, honeycombed surfaces and porous concrete.
Interruption in pouring the concrete can cause the to begin with put materials to start to set prior to the up coming batch is additional on prime. This makes a horizontal plane of weak spot named a chilly joint between the two batches.
The hydration course of action is exothermic, which suggests that ambient temperature performs an important job in how much time it will take concrete to set. Frequently, additives (including pozzolans or superplasticizers) are included in the mixture to improve the Bodily Homes with the damp combine, delay or accelerate the curing time, or normally modify the completed substance. Most structural concrete is poured with reinforcing elements (for example steel rebar) embedded to offer tensile power, yielding reinforced concrete.
